Epithemia cistula var. acuta Cleve-Euler 1932
Publication Details
Epithemia cistula var. acuta Cleve-Euler 1932: 34, fig. 65
Published in: Cleve-Euler, A. (1932). Die Kieselalgen des Tåkernsees in Schweden. Kungliga Svenska Vetenskaps-Akademiens Handlingar, ser. 3 11(2): 1-254.
Type Species
The type species (lectotype) of the genus Epithemia is Epithemia turgida (Ehrenberg) Kützing.
Status of Name
This name is currently regarded as a synonym of Epithemia sorex f. acuta (Cleve-Euler) Berg.
Origin of Species Name
Noun (Latin), cistula f., a basket; a small chest.
General Environment
This is a freshwater species.
